"La
Ferme aux Chouettes" is a lovingly restored 18th century farmhouse
set in its own two acres of land.
Most of the original oak beams have been retained and the stonework
exposed giving the house a
wonderful traditional feel, yet here you
will find all mod cons to make your stay an enjoyable one. |

Situation:
|
|
Situated inthe Vienne department (86) at a criss-cross of local designated
walks through miles of open unspoiled countryside. Marked 7, 10 and
15 km routes pass by the gates. River Charente
- 5 mins walk - boat hire by the ancient Roman bridge. Fishing permits
are for sale at the local Chatain bar. Bonnezac
- close to the ancient town of Charroux where Charlemagne's
tower is a popular attraction and the old covered market welcomes a
weekly crowd as do the bars and restaurants. Civray
- several kms away - excellent weekly market and beautiful medieval
church. Poitiers and Angoulême are
about an hours drive away as is the popular and unique Futuroscope.
